represents another sophisticated layer of biological intervention. Peptides, chains of amino acids, function as signaling molecules. They instruct cells to perform specific actions, initiating cascades that regulate metabolism, repair mechanisms, and growth. These molecular messengers deliver precise commands to cellular architects, directing them to rebuild, regenerate, or optimize.

Consider some prominent examples ∞

  • Sermorelin, a growth hormone-releasing hormone (GHRH) analogue, stimulates the pituitary gland to produce more endogenous growth hormone. This avoids the supraphysiological spikes associated with direct growth hormone administration, promoting a natural, pulsatile release. Its impact includes enhanced cellular repair, improved body composition, and more restful sleep cycles.

  • BPC-157, a gastric pentadecapeptide, demonstrates remarkable regenerative properties. It accelerates tissue repair, reduces inflammation, and supports gut integrity. Athletes and active individuals frequently leverage this peptide for expedited recovery from injuries and for general musculoskeletal well-being.
  • Ipamorelin, another GHRH mimetic, works synergistically with Sermorelin.

    It selectively stimulates growth hormone release with minimal impact on cortisol or prolactin levels, offering a clean, targeted signal for regenerative processes. Combined protocols with these peptides orchestrate a powerful internal symphony of repair and revitalization.

Administration methods vary. Testosterone can be delivered via intramuscular injection, transdermal creams, or subcutaneous pellets, each offering distinct advantages in terms of absorption and sustained release. Peptides are typically administered via subcutaneous injection, allowing for direct systemic delivery and rapid cellular engagement. Patient education regarding proper technique ensures maximal efficacy and safety.
